Transaction 66c94b964d2f3f74143f4858da7f51bd07fa33fc9ed504a7bc0e7641a4ecc869

1 Input
2 Outputs
  • 66c94b964d2f3f74143f4858da7f51bd07fa33fc9ed504a7bc0e7641a4ecc869:0
  • value  200000000
    address  39SE7zYb6aRGd4zE4RUs9MUMHQhcfKK9jN
  • 66c94b964d2f3f74143f4858da7f51bd07fa33fc9ed504a7bc0e7641a4ecc869:1
  • value  699998644
    address  1K1HtN6AZZJ4LziQGAeNTs5F2F65aT5WJi